Louisiana State Employees Retirement System Sells 10,300 Shares of EMCOR Group, Inc. $EME

Louisiana State Employees Retirement System decreased its holdings in shares of EMCOR Group, Inc. (NYSE:EMEFree Report) by 81.7% in the 3rd qu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 2,300 shares of the construction company’s stock after selling 10,300 shares during the quarter. Louisiana State Employees Retirement System’s holdings in EMCOR Group were worth $1,494,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

EMCOR Group (NYSE:EMEG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, October 30th. The construction company reported $6.57 EPS for the quarter, hitting analysts’ consensus estimates of $6.57. EMCOR Group had a net margin of 6.96% and a return on equity of 37.04%. The business had revenue of $4.30 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.27 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$5.80 earnings per share.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 16.4% on a year-over-year basis. EMCOR Group has set its FY 2025 guidance at 25.000-25.75 EPS. As a group, analysts anticipate that EMCOR Group, Inc. will post 20.74 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About EMCOR Group

(Free Report)

EMCOR Group, Inc is a provider of mechanical and electrical construction, industrial and energy infrastructure, and facilities services to commercial, institutional and industrial clients. The company delivers a broad range of services that include design-build and traditional construction of mechanical, electrical and plumbing systems; ongoing facilities maintenance and operations; and specialized industrial services for sectors such as manufacturing, data centers, healthcare and utilities.

EMCOR’s service offerings encompass HVAC, plumbing, electrical installation and maintenance, fire protection, building automation and controls, commissioning, testing and balancing, and energy management solutions.
